Trading at approximately $0.000034, Bonk emerged as a standout performer during Solana’s recovery period, capturing attention as the blockchain’s premier meme token. The project benefits from strong community support and accessibility for retail investors, though its functionality remains limited. Bonk’s success largely depends on maintaining viral appeal and the continued strength of the Solana ecosystem, rather than groundbreaking technological innovations.

Currently priced around $0.000015, Shiba Inu maintains its position as a household name in the cryptocurrency space. The project has evolved beyond its meme origins by developing infrastructure including Shibarium and ShibaSwap, demonstrating commitment to long-term growth. Despite these improvements, the token’s massive supply and already substantial market capitalization create challenges for achieving the explosive gains that characterized its earlier performance.
